Vote: 5-0 in favor. <br /> 8:25pm <br /> DEP File No.201-996, BL 953 <br /> NOI, 16 Summer Street <br /> Applicant/owner: Gabler Realty Trust <br /> Project: Proposed completion of landscape work, construction of a shed, extension a driveway <br /> within the 100-foot Buffer Zone of Bordering Vegetated Wetlands and Bank, and conduct <br /> restoration activities <br /> Documents: Survey dated 10/19/2015, Drainage plan dated 10/15/2015, Building plan dated <br /> 10/2/2015, and abutter's letters dated 9/24/2015 <br /> Mike Novak- Meridian Engineering. <br /> Mr. Novak explained that he had completed a drainage analysis on the property. On the proposed <br /> plan they have added a path to have access down to the stream, an addition to the paved portion <br /> of the driveway, and a stone infiltration trench. He explained that they would be doing 375 sq <br /> feet of restoration. He stated the fence would be placed three feet off the property line. <br /> Comments and concerns from the commission: <br /> The commission requested clarification of the soil types. <br /> The commission wanted confirmation on the shed setbacks. <br /> The commission raised a question about the tree's being cut down along the property line. <br /> The commission questioned whether the new impervious surface would by pass by the <br /> infiltration system or go into it. <br />
